IdentifiantMot de passe
Loading...
Mot de passe oublié ?Je m'inscris ! (gratuit)
Navigation

Inscrivez-vous gratuitement
pour pouvoir participer, suivre les réponses en temps réel, voter pour les messages, poser vos propres questions et recevoir la newsletter

Langage PHP Discussion :

[PHP/JQuery] Affichage d'information dynamique [PHP 7]


Sujet :

Langage PHP

Vue hybride

Message précédent Message précédent   Message suivant Message suivant
  1. #1
    Candidat au Club
    Femme Profil pro
    Technicien maintenance
    Inscrit en
    Juillet 2018
    Messages
    2
    Détails du profil
    Informations personnelles :
    Sexe : Femme
    Localisation : France, Rhône (Rhône Alpes)

    Informations professionnelles :
    Activité : Technicien maintenance
    Secteur : Alimentation

    Informations forums :
    Inscription : Juillet 2018
    Messages : 2
    Par défaut [PHP/JQuery] Affichage d'information dynamique
    Bonjour à tous,
    Pour situer ma demande, j'ai une base de données sur laquelle je tape pour générer un formulaire. Dans le cas présent, j'ai la table "issue" (dont le nom est tout indiqué ici ) qui contient les colonnes, entre autres, "designation" et "suggestion".
    Je génère le SELECT de mon formulaire sur la base de la désignation, ce qui est somme toute logique :
    Code : Sélectionner tout - Visualiser dans une fenêtre à part
    1
    2
    3
    4
    while($data = $query->fetch())
    {
        echo "<OPTION VAlUE=".$data['id_issue'].">".$data['designation'];
    }
    Pour ça aucun souci. Seulement, je voudrais que selon la valeur choisie dans mon SELECT, je puisse afficher le contenu de "suggestion" (attention, il n'y a pas forcément une suggestion par ligne, dans certains cas le champ est vide et je voyais bien écrire un message type "aucune suggestion, continuez") qui est un lien vers une page. Je n'ai pas trouvé de solution que ce soit en PHP ou en JQuery... Ou du moins, je vois des solutions mais ça impliquerait de le faire "à la main" pour toutes les lignes de ma base de données puis de faire des show/hide en JQuery... C'est lourd et pas vraiment maintenable. Quelqu'un a une idée sur la marche à suivre pour résoudre ce problème ?
    Désolé si ce n'est pas clair.

    Merci d'avance

  2. #2
    Membre émérite Avatar de Geoffrey74
    Homme Profil pro
    Développeur Web
    Inscrit en
    Mars 2007
    Messages
    515
    Détails du profil
    Informations personnelles :
    Sexe : Homme
    Âge : 39
    Localisation : France, Isère (Rhône Alpes)

    Informations professionnelles :
    Activité : Développeur Web
    Secteur : High Tech - Multimédia et Internet

    Informations forums :
    Inscription : Mars 2007
    Messages : 515
    Par défaut
    Salut,

    Essai de regarder par là : https://siddh.developpez.com/articles/ajax/#LIV-A

    Tu y trouvera sans doute ton bonheur.

  3. #3
    Candidat au Club
    Femme Profil pro
    Technicien maintenance
    Inscrit en
    Juillet 2018
    Messages
    2
    Détails du profil
    Informations personnelles :
    Sexe : Femme
    Localisation : France, Rhône (Rhône Alpes)

    Informations professionnelles :
    Activité : Technicien maintenance
    Secteur : Alimentation

    Informations forums :
    Inscription : Juillet 2018
    Messages : 2
    Par défaut
    Cela fonctionne, merci beaucoup !

+ Répondre à la discussion
Cette discussion est résolue.

Discussions similaires

  1. Réponses: 2
    Dernier message: 21/08/2014, 09h46
  2. Réponses: 2
    Dernier message: 28/06/2012, 14h13
  3. Affichage d'image dynamique en PHP via DreamWeaver
    Par fidecourt dans le forum Langage
    Réponses: 1
    Dernier message: 13/05/2007, 15h25
  4. affichage de tableau dynamique
    Par EJ dans le forum XMLRAD
    Réponses: 12
    Dernier message: 04/06/2004, 10h58
  5. [MX 2004] Affichage du texte dynamique
    Par caramel dans le forum Flash
    Réponses: 8
    Dernier message: 29/01/2004, 16h07

Partager

Partager
  • Envoyer la discussion sur Viadeo
  • Envoyer la discussion sur Twitter
  • Envoyer la discussion sur Google
  • Envoyer la discussion sur Facebook
  • Envoyer la discussion sur Digg
  • Envoyer la discussion sur Delicious
  • Envoyer la discussion sur MySpace
  • Envoyer la discussion sur Yahoo